forked from qt-creator/qt-creator
Botan: Don't unconditionally build in release mode.
Mixing debug and release mode is a bad idea in general and does not even work on some platforms. Change-Id: I0e112de1f3e878c5d8f3b57789df194c772848ae Reviewed-by: Andreas Holzammer <andreas.holzammer@kdab.com> Reviewed-by: Friedemann Kleint <Friedemann.Kleint@nokia.com>
This commit is contained in:
committed by
Friedemann Kleint
parent
2cf04cb248
commit
c216863cf7
2
src/libs/3rdparty/botan/botan.pri
vendored
2
src/libs/3rdparty/botan/botan.pri
vendored
@@ -1,2 +1,2 @@
|
|||||||
INCLUDEPATH *= $$PWD/..
|
INCLUDEPATH *= $$PWD/..
|
||||||
LIBS += -lBotan # Don't use qtLibraryName. Botan is always built in release mode.
|
LIBS *= -l$$qtLibraryName(Botan)
|
||||||
|
7
src/libs/3rdparty/botan/botan.pro
vendored
7
src/libs/3rdparty/botan/botan.pro
vendored
@@ -3,15 +3,12 @@ TARGET = Botan
|
|||||||
|
|
||||||
PRECOMPILED_HEADER = ../precompiled_headers/botan_pch.h
|
PRECOMPILED_HEADER = ../precompiled_headers/botan_pch.h
|
||||||
|
|
||||||
QT =
|
|
||||||
|
|
||||||
CONFIG += exceptions
|
CONFIG += exceptions
|
||||||
CONFIG += release
|
|
||||||
CONFIG -= debug debug_and_release
|
|
||||||
include(../../../qtcreatorlibrary.pri)
|
include(../../../qtcreatorlibrary.pri)
|
||||||
|
|
||||||
DEPENDPATH += .
|
DEPENDPATH += .
|
||||||
INCLUDEPATH += . $$[QT_INSTALL_HEADERS] $$[QT_INSTALL_HEADERS]/QtCore
|
INCLUDEPATH += .
|
||||||
|
|
||||||
DEFINES += BOTAN_DLL=Q_DECL_EXPORT
|
DEFINES += BOTAN_DLL=Q_DECL_EXPORT
|
||||||
unix:DEFINES += BOTAN_TARGET_OS_HAS_GETTIMEOFDAY BOTAN_HAS_ALLOC_MMAP \
|
unix:DEFINES += BOTAN_TARGET_OS_HAS_GETTIMEOFDAY BOTAN_HAS_ALLOC_MMAP \
|
||||||
|
Reference in New Issue
Block a user